Description

The term “supergroup” is usually applied to bands, but it feels appropriate when talking about the founders of this Williamsburg bar, restaurant and dance spot; it includes Battery Harris restaurateurs David Shapiro and Etan Fraiman and members of several modern-legend DJ outfits, such as Mizrahi (Wolf+Lamb), Eli Goldstein (Soul Clap) and Philipp Jung (M.A.N.D.Y.). On the ground floor you’ll find the dancing and DJ booth, which fills the night with deep house cuts and vertical neon lights. Upstairs you’ll be able to hear yourself talk while you dine on delicious Cuban-Nuevo Latino vegan and vegetarian dishes from chef Ben Dawson.
